数据库|第一章|绪论

1.数据库的四个基本概念

  • 数据:是数据库中存储的基本对象。描述事物的符号记录称为数据,书具有多种表现形式。数据的含义称为数据的语义,数据与其语义是不可分的
  • 数据库(DB):数据库是长期储存在计算机内有组织的可共享的大量数据的集合。数据库中的数据按一定的数据模型组织、描述和存储,具有较小的冗余度较高的数据独立性易扩展性,并为各种用户共享,概括地讲,数据库数据具有永久存储、有组织和可共享三个基本特点。
  • 数据库管理系统:计算机的基础软件,主要功能包括
    (1)数据定义
    (2)数据组织、存储和管理
    (3)数据操纵
    (4)数据库的事务管理和运行管理
    (5)数据库的建立和维护
    (6)其他功能
  • 数据库系统:由数据库数据库管理系统(及其应用开发工具)、应用程序数据库管理员(DBA)组成的存储管理处理维护数据的系统

2.数据库管理技术的产生和发展

  • 人工管理阶段
    (1)数据不保存
    (2)应用程序管理数据
    (3)数据不共享
    (4)数据不具独立性
  • 文件系统阶段
    优点
    (1)数据可以长期保存
    (2)由文件系统管理数据
    缺点
    (1)数据共享性差,冗余度大
    (2)数据独立性差,具备设备(物理)独立性,不具备数据(逻辑)独立性
  • 数据库系统阶段
    (1)从文件系统到数据库系统标志着数据管理技术的飞跃
    (2)数据库系统的特点
    ·数据结构化。所谓“整体”结构化是指数据库中的数据不再仅仅针对某一应用,而是面向整个组织或企业;不仅数据内部是结构化的,而且整体是结构化的,数据之间是具有联系的。
    ·数据的共享性高,冗余度低且易扩充。数据共享可以大大减少数据冗余,节约存储空间,数据共享还能避免数据之间的不相容性与不一致性。
    ·数据独立性高。物理独立性是指用户的应用程序与数据库中数据的物理存储是相互独立的,逻辑独立性是指用户的应用程序与数据库的逻辑结构是相互独立的。
    ·数据由数据库管理系统统一管理和控制
posted @ 2020-09-09 23:35  zzzmmm37  阅读(206)  评论(0)    收藏  举报